You can disable this option through the registry: REG add "HKLM\SOFTWARE\Policies\Microsoft\Windows NT\Terminal Services" /v fPromptForPassword /t REG_DWORD /d 0 /f. We have had this option for standard remote desktop connections for some time, through the local or group policy and the H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Policies\Microsoft\Windows NT\Terminal Services\fPromptForPassword registry key.
